   KVR16LE11L/8
   
  8GB 2Rx8 1G x 72-Bit PC3L-12800
   
  CL11 240-Pin ECC DIMM
   
  DESCRIPTION
   
  This document describes ValueRAM's 1G x 72-bit (8GB) DDR3L-1600 CL11 SDRAM (Synchronous DRAM), 2Rx8, ECC, low voltage, memory module, based on eighteen 512M x 8-bit FBGA components. The SPD is programmed to JEDEC stan-dard latency DDR3-1600 timing of 11-11-11 at 1.35V or 1.5V. This 240-pin DIMM uses gold contact fingers. The electrical and mechanical specifications are as follows
   
  Features
   
  JEDEC standard 1.35V (1.28V ~ 1.45V) and 1.5V (1.425V ~1.575V) Power Supply
  VDDQ = 1.35V (1.28V ~ 1.45V) and 1.5V (1.425V ~ 1.575V)
  800MHz fCK for 1600Mb/sec/pin
  8 independent internal bank 
  Programmable CAS Latency: 11, 10, 9, 8, 7, 6
  Programmable Additive Latency: 0, CL - 2, or CL - 1 clock
  8-bit pre-fetch
  Burst Length: 8 (Interleave without any limit, sequential with starting address 000 only), 4 with tCCD = 4 which does not allow seamless read or write [either on the fly using A12 or MRS]
  Bi-directional Differential Data Strobe
  Thermal Sensor Grade B
  Internal(self) calibration : Internal self calibration through ZQ pin (RZQ : 240 ohm 1%)
  On Die Termination using ODT pin
  Average Refresh Period 7.8us at lower than TCASE 85C, 3.9us at 85C < TCASE  < 95C
  Asynchronous Reset
  PCB: Height 0.740 (18.75mm), double sided component
   
  SPECIFICATIONS
   
  CL(IDD) 11 cycles
  Row Cycle Time (tRCmin) 48.125ns (min.)
  Refresh to Active/Refresh 260ns (min.)
  Command Time (tRFCmin)
  Row Active Time (tRASmin) 35ns (min.)
  Maximum Operating Power (1.35V) = 1.956 W* (1.50V) = 2.443 W*
  UL Rating 94 V - 0
  Operating Temperature 0oC to 85oC
  Storage Temperature -55oC to +100oC
